平台直播下载地址格式解析,直播资源链接的常见类型与识别方法
直播下载地址的本质特征
什么是平台直播下载地址?本质上是媒体资源定位符(MRL)的特殊变体,既包含传统URL的网络定位属性,又集成流媒体传输协议特征。其核心构成要素可分解为:
- 协议标识:http/https/ftp等基础协议占73%,RTMP/RTSP等流媒体专用协议占21%
- 域名层级:主域名(如live.example.com)+ 子目录(/videos/)+ 资源编号
- 参数体系:?token=xxx&resolution=1080p等验证与画质控制参数
主流格式的横向对比
通过对比三大类地址格式发现显著差异:
类型 | 示例 | 适用场景 | 解码难度 |
---|---|---|---|
明文直链 | `https://cdn.example.com/live/1234.mp4` | 点播回放 | ★☆☆☆☆ |
动态加密 | `rtmp://live.example.com:1935/app?token=5A3F2E` | 实时直播 | ★★★☆☆ |
混合嵌套 | `https://api.example.com/stream.m3u8?key=ZXCVB` | 多码率自适应 | ★★★★☆ |
为什么不同平台采用不同格式?主要受三方面因素驱动:
1. 版权保护需求(加密动态链接占比提升37%)
2. 带宽优化考虑(m3u8分片传输节省22%流量)
3. 设备兼容要求(RTSP在监控设备保有量达89%)
技术实现的关键要点
如何准确识别下载地址?需要掌握三个技术特征:
1.协议嗅探:Wireshark抓包显示,有效直播链接必含`Content-Type: video/`报文头
2.结构规律:抖音/TikTok类平台采用`/aweme/v1/play/?video_id=`的固定路径结构
3.参数验证:虎牙直播的`cid`参数与B站的`avid`参数存在可追溯的映射关系
下载失败的常见原因按频率排序为:
- 时效过期(占比42%,尤其是临时token链接)
- 地域封锁(31%,通过检测X-Forwarded-For字段实现)
- 签名错误(19%,HMAC-SHA256校验失败)
未来演进趋势观察
WebRTC技术的普及使`webrtc://`协议地址增长210%,其特点在于:
- 完全绕过传统CDN架构
- 端到端加密无法被常规工具捕获
- 需要SDP交换才能建立连接
而区块链技术的应用催生出新型NFT直播地址,典型如`nftlive://artblock.io/7312`,其特殊性在于:
1. 智能合约控制访问权限
2. 下载行为自动触发代币结算
3. 资源哈希值永久上链存证
当前技术条件下,最可靠的下载方案仍是平台官方工具,第三方解析工具存在89.7%的合规风险。直播行业的版权保护技术每年迭代2.4次,这与下载技术的博弈将持续升级。